The separation of uranium from synthetic Hanford site groundwater by liquid-liquid extraction and by supported liquid membranes (SLM) waa studied. Bis(2,4,4-trimethylpentyl) phosphinic acid, H[DTMPeP], contained in the commercial extractant Cyanex 272, was selected for the membrane carrier because of its selectivity for uranium over calcium and magnesium. n-Dodecane was used as diluent and polypropylene membranea were used aa the support. A water soluble complexing agent, 1-hydroxyethane-1,1—dinheaohnnic acid. HEDPA. was used aa atripping agent. © 1990, Taylor & Francis Group, LLC. All rights reserved.
